Tele-ICU is broadly defined as a system that utilizes remote monitoring technology to promote the efficient deployment of intensivist and critical care resources.
The ICU environment continuously accosts clinicians with distractions, alarms, and interruptions that generates a potential for a rise in error rates. While addressing the needs of one patient, the physicians may be unaware of another patient’s change in status that requires immediate attention. These are the second set of eyes that provides additional clinical surveillance and support. It has the potential to support without distraction and deliver timely interventions in cases where minutes may make a vast difference. The purpose of these systems is not to replace bedside clinicians, but to provide improved safety through redundancy and enhance outcomes through standardization.
The healthcare team usually requires the same access as the bedside team to data elements related to patients (e.g., vital signs, results of laboratory tests, radiologic images, orders, and notes) to assess patients’ status accurately and identify actual and potential issues concerning the patients. The use of sophisticated alert systems enables subtle changes in a patient’s condition to be assessed for early intervention and prevention of a crisis for the patient. Devices like high-resolution zoom cameras, microphones, and speakers are generally mounted in the ICU patient’s room, providing the Tele-ICU 1-way or 2-way video/audio assessment capability and bedside communication.

Telemedicine enables nurses, nurse practitioners, physicians, and other healthcare professionals to provide patient monitoring and intervention from remote locations. The presence of Tele-ICU has demonstrated positive outcomes such as increased adherence to evidence-based care and improved perception of support at the bedside. In spite of the successes, acceptance of Tele-ICU varies. Some barriers to acceptance include perceptions of intrusiveness and invasion of privacy.

- Tele-Intensive Care Unit systems continuously monitor and alert staff about acute changes or trends in physiology. The team in the Tele-ICU used video and audio technology to perform assessments and communicate with patients, their families, and loved ones, as well as caregivers. Tele-ICU team members place orders, review laboratory test results and imaging studies, and write progress notes.
